5’7”...Named Golf Digest’s 1983 Rookie of the Year...Named Professional Female Athlete of the Year by the San Jose Sports Association in 1985...Married, husband Brian is a golf pro...Gave birth to first child, daughter Hayley Carole, in 1990...Gave birth to second daughter, Cori Simpson, in 1994...Maiden name is Simpson...Plays out of Los Altos Country Club...Voted 1999 Female Player of the Year by the Golf Writers Association of America (GWAA)...Recognized during the LPGA’s 50th Anniversary in 2000 as one of the LPGA’s top-50 players and teachers...In 2000, was honored by ESPN with the ESPY Award for Outstanding Women’s Golf Performer of the Year...Received the 2004 Thomas P. Infusino Award, given by the ShopRite LPGA Classic to recognize an individual who has had a large role in the growth and success of the tournament…In October 2007, traveled to Rwanda on a mission trip with Betsy King and Golf Fore Africa…Member of the LPGA Player Executive Committee for the 2002-04 and 2007-09 seasons...Recipient of the 2008 ASAP Sports/Jim Murray Award given by the GWAA.
